Output e8bb9bbe221481eec2a9db3a7c45ce13e8b5e9c03787229981c03e48931fb3f7:3

value
150816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4660318bffcec04777e3f271922f51f209866094 OP_EQUAL
address
3878Tchmyok6r9VUQfmp7EUjLHhgRdzYfF
transaction
e8bb9bbe221481eec2a9db3a7c45ce13e8b5e9c03787229981c03e48931fb3f7
confirmations
111662
spent
true